How they compare

Ethiopia currently reports 0.207 kt against 0.1869 kt in Nepal, a difference of 0.0201 kt.

That makes Ethiopia's figure about 1.1 times Nepal's.

The two have swapped places 9 times across 31 shared years of data; in 1993 it was Nepal ahead.

Ethiopia ranks 53rd and Nepal ranks 56th of 182 countries.

Nepal has averaged higher in every one of the 4 decades both report.

The FAOSTAT domain on Emissions from Energy use in agriculture contains data on energy used in agriculture (including forestry, aquaculture and fisheries), for instance to operate machinery, irrigate, heat stables, operate aquaculture ponds and fishing vessels, and related greenhouse gas (GHG) emissions. It also includes on-farm use of, and related GHG emissions from, electricity and heat generated off-farm. Data are available by country and regional groups with global coverage and are updated annually.
